This shift can result in lower trading volumes across various exchanges. What Are Perpetual Contracts and Why Are They Important? Perpetual contracts are a popular instrument in the derivatives market, allowing traders to speculate on the price movements of cryptocurrencies without an expiration date. Unlike standard futures contracts, they're designed to track the underlying asset price closely.
